How they compare
Uruguay currently reports 44,491 1000 SLC against 41,429 1000 SLC in Kazakhstan, a difference of 3,062 1000 SLC.
That makes Uruguay's figure about 1.1 times Kazakhstan's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 24 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Uruguay ahead.
Kazakhstan ranks 19th and Uruguay ranks 18th of 34 countries.
Uruguay has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Kazakhstan | Uruguay |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 11,637 1000 SLC | 73,918 1000 SLC | 62,281 1000 SLC | Uruguay |
| 2010s | 32,679 1000 SLC | 36,097 1000 SLC | 3,418 1000 SLC | Uruguay |
| 2020s | 41,512 1000 SLC | 44,581 1000 SLC | 3,069 1000 SLC | Uruguay |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
